VariableRuntimeDxe deletes and locks the MorLock variable in
MorLockInit(), with the argument that any protection provided by MorLock
can be circumvented if MorLock can be overwritten by unprivileged code
(i.e., outside of SMM).

Extend the argument and the logic to the MOR variable, which is supposed
to be protected by MorLock. Pass Attributes=0 when deleting MorLock and
MOR both.

This change was suggested by Star; it is inspired by earlier VariableSmm
commit fda8f631edbb ("MdeModulePkg/Variable/RuntimeDxe: delete and lock
OS-created MOR variable", 2017-10-03).

+  //
+  // The MOR variable can effectively improve platform security only when the
+  // MorLock variable protects the MOR variable. In turn MorLock cannot be made
+  // secure without SMM support in the platform firmware (see above).
+  //
+  // Thus, delete the MOR variable, should it exist for any reason (some OSes
+  // are known to create MOR unintentionally, in an attempt to set it), then
+  // also lock the MOR variable, in order to prevent other modules from
+  // creating it.
+  //
